Casey Jones by Jerry Garcia and Robert Hunter, performed by Glenn Weiser on guitar, harmonica, electric bass and vocals.
Many songs have written about the heroic Mississippi railway engineer who in 1900 died a heros' death in a head-on train collision slowing down his locomotive to save the passengers and crew in the oncoming train.
According to Grateful Dead biographer Dennis McNally, Hunter had a dream in which he saw the words to the song written on a piece of paper. Garcia then set the verses to music.
Here the harmonica begins with train sounds, you hear the train wreck, and then the acoustic fingerstyle arrangement begins.
